What companies run services between Inverness, Scotland and Chessington World of Adventures, England?

London North Eastern Railway Limited (LNER) operates a train from Inverness to King's Cross twice daily. Tickets cost £121–126 and the journey takes 7h 52m. Alternatively, you can take a bus from Union Street to Chessington World of Adventures via Buchanan Bus Station, Heathrow Central Bus Station, Cromwell Road Bus Station, and Chessington World Of Adventures in around 14h 7m.
